Can Tho is one of the stops not to be missed on the journey to visit the Mekong Delta provinces.

The two-day itinerary in Can Tho below is according to the advice of Ms. Do Vy, tour guide of Con Son Tourism Cooperative (Can Tho City) and the experience of Vinlove . This is a suitable trip for people who have little time, but still want to visit all the popular spots and eat typical dishes in Can Tho.

Day 1

Morning and noon

Have breakfast in the city center with the recommended dish being noodles. Can Tho is one of the best places to eat Nam Vang noodle soup in the West. The main ingredients are rice noodles, broth from minced meat, and pork intestines. Some additional but indispensable ingredients are bean sprouts, chives, minced meat, beef balls and some other ingredients depending on the restaurant. Reference shop: A Dai, Huynh Ky, Ngoc Ngan.

The next trip in the morning is to visit Con Son. This is a small island located in the middle of the Hau River, about 7 km from the city center. “If you don’t have much time, the half-day Con Son tour is a suitable choice for tourists who want to learn about the life of the southern river region,” Do Vy said.

Con Son tour usually departs from the city center, from 8:00 a.m. or 2:00 p.m. Price fluctuates around 250,000 VND per person. Normally, meals are paid for by tourists themselves. If there is a need to include it in the tour, visitors can book in advance.

Evening

After returning to the city center, visitors should not miss one of the famous attractions in Can Tho, Binh Thuy ancient house.

The house is located on Bui Huu Nghia street, about 8 km from the center. Binh Thuy ancient house is owned by the Duong family, built in 1870. This was the setting of famous movies such as Lover, Alluvial Roads, Tay Do Beauty. Opening hours are from 8:00 a.m. to 12:00 p.m. and from 2:00 p.m. to 6:00 p.m. Sightseeing ticket costs 15,000 VND per person.

“This is a beautiful place to take photos, so tourists, especially women, should choose light clothes, maybe like the main character in the movie Lover , ” Vy added.

In the evening, one of the options is to walk and browse Ninh Kieu wharf night market, Tay Do night market, focusing mainly on Hai Ba Trung, Nguyen Thai Hoc, and Tran Phu streets. The market is usually open from after 4:00 p.m. until late at night, with many shops selling on mobile carts, snacks, baked goods, and fruit stalls.

End the day with a walk at Ninh Kieu pedestrian bridge, also known as Can Tho love bridge. The bridge was built in 2016, and is one of the most popular tourist destinations, especially in the evening.

Overnight at hotel in Ninh Kieu district along Hau river. This is a convenient location for travel and is also home to many hotels. The average price ranges from 500,000 VND to 800,000 VND per night.

Day 2

Morning and noon

Get up early to go to Cai Rang floating market. This is a characteristic feature of the lives of people in the Western river region. Trading activities are no longer as busy as before, there are very few boats buying and selling local agricultural products on the river, but if it is the first time coming to Can Tho, visitors should still have the experience of visiting the floating market.

Currently, boats on Hau River mainly serve tourists, selling food such as vermicelli noodles, noodles, coffee and fruits (usually pre-peeled ones for customers to eat on the spot).

Tourists arriving at Ninh Kieu wharf can immediately buy tickets to board the boat. Visitors can also book boat tickets to visit the floating market in advance on a tour or at the hotel. Visiting the floating market is free, but taking a boat will cost from 80,000 to 100,000 VND per person, depending on the type of boat and number of guests. Time to visit the floating market ranges from 2 to 4 hours.

Lunch at Hoi That restaurant. This is one of the authentic Western country rice restaurants located in the center of Can Tho City, in a small alley on Tran Binh Trong Street, Ninh Kieu District. Dishes at the restaurant include pickles, boiled vegetables dipped in braised sauce, fried eggs, stir-fried water spinach with garlic, pork belly mixed with garlic and chili, braised meat with shrimp paste, braised fish, and sour basa fish soup. The restaurant is a 4-level house, with two dining areas: indoor and outdoor. Food served in rustic earthenware dishes.

In the evening, spend time walking in the city center. Can Tho is the center and most modern city in the Mekong Delta. In addition to the places visited above, in the city there are also Can Tho Bridge, Ong Pagoda, Phat Hoc Pagoda, Can Tho Museum.

Sit in coffee and watch the sunset on Hau River at one of the shops like Song Hau Coffee, Song Tho Cuisine (both food and drink). Dinner at Thanh Giao duck restaurant in an alley on Ly Tu Trong street.

If you do not follow the above schedule, visitors can choose some alternative destinations such as: My Khanh tourist village, Ong De ecological area, Bang Lang stork garden. Note the distance and travel method to schedule accordingly. In the evening, if you don’t like walking, you can choose to take the tram around Can Tho at night or have dinner on a large cruise ship along the Hau River. Remember to bargain carefully at the night market and choose reputable boats.

($1=24,000 VND)
